Colombian artist José Antonio Suárez Londoño has devoted four decades to drawing. Through this disciplined, daily practice he has developed a vast repertoire of small-scale drawings. For his first exhibition in the UK, Londoño has selected one hundred drawings and fifty etchings, spanning two decades of work. This catalogue includes over 100 works on paper made between 1997 and 2018, as well as an essay by Isabel Seligman and an exclusive conversation between Ketty Gottardo and the artist.
